- /*!
- * \typedef RINGBUF
- * \brief Character device ring buffer type.
- */
- typedef struct _RINGBUF RINGBUF;
- /*!
- * \struct _RINGBUF usart.h dev/usart.h
- * \brief Character device ring buffer structure.
- */
- struct _RINGBUF {
- /*! \brief Buffer head pointer.
- *
- * Changed by the receiver interrupt.
- */
- u_char * volatile rbf_head;
- /*! \brief Buffer tail pointer.
- *
- * Changed by the transmitter interrupt.
- */
- u_char * volatile rbf_tail;
- /*! \brief First buffer address.
- */
- u_char *rbf_start;
- /*! \brief Last buffer address.
- */
- u_char *rbf_last;
- /*! \brief Total buffer size.
- *
- * Zero, if no buffer available.
- */
- size_t rbf_siz;
- /*! \brief Number of bytes in the buffer.
- *
- * Changed by receiver and transmitter interrupts.
- */
- volatile size_t rbf_cnt;
- /*! \brief Buffer low watermark.
- *
- * If the number of bytes in the buffer reaches this value, then
- * the previously disabled buffer input is enabled again.
- */
- size_t rbf_lwm;
- /*! \brief Buffer high watermark.
- *
- * If the number of bytes in the buffer reaches this value, then
- * buffer input is disabled.
- */
- size_t rbf_hwm;
- /*! \brief Queue of waiting threads.
- *
- * Consuming threads are added to this queue when the buffer is empty.
- * Producing threads are added to this queue when the buffer is full.
- */
- HANDLE rbf_que;
- #ifdef UART_BLOCKING_READ
- /*! \brief Number of bytes for block-read
- *
- * If this is zero, incoming bytes are stored in ringbuffer
- * If this not zero, incoming bytes are stored in rbf_blockptr
- * Changed by the receiver interrupt.
- */
- size_t volatile rbf_blockcnt;
-
- /*! \brief Address for block-read
- *
- * If bf_blockbytes is not zero, incoming bytes are stored here
- * Changed by the receiver interrupt.
- */
- u_char* volatile rbf_blockptr;
- #endif
- };

- /*! \brief Software handshake.
- *
- * It is recommended to set a proper read timeout with software handshake.
- * In this case a timeout may occur, if the communication peer lost our
- * last XON character. The application may then use ioctl() to disable the
- * receiver and do the read again. This will send out another XON.
- */
- #define USART_MF_XONXOFF 0x0020
